Campsite #19 Features: Drive-In access, Back-In parking, 30ft driveway, 100 amp hookup, Fire ring, Picnic Table, Cabin Site, Pets Allowed, Drinking Water

This was our second experience at Red Bridge. We used a tent site the first year. We rented a cabin this time. The check in process was a little hazy until arriving at the campground, but we figured it out fairly soon after arrival. The cabin was great. I was spacious and clean. The mattresses are pretty hard, so I would bring air mattresses if we rent a cabin again in the future. Overall, we really like the campground. It is well kept and a family friendly atmosphere. There’s plenty to do in the area or it’s great to just relax at the campsite.
